HZN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2023 in Review
0 of the 6,276 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Horizon Global Corporation (HZN) for Q1 2023, worth a combined $0 — down 100% from $5.43M a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 31 funds closed out of HZN and 0 opened new positions — a net loss of 31 holders — while 0 trimmed existing stakes and 0 added.
The largest seller was T. Rowe Price Investment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$1.77M sold.
